In the e1000-5.2.30.1 driver, "they" no longer propagate pdev->irq into netdev->irq. This looks safe to add back in, am I mistaken? I want ifconfig to report the irq, which it no longer does without netdev->irq.
This is on a 2.4 kernel (no MSI).
